Taxonomic Classification

Rank Black-handed Titi Hairy-legged Vampire Bat
Kingdom same Animalia (hayvan) Animalia (hayvan)
Phylum same Chordata (Kordalılar) Chordata (Kordalılar)
Class same Mammalia (memeliler) Mammalia (memeliler)
Order Primates (Primat) Chiroptera (yarasa)
Family Pitheciidae Phyllostomidae
Genus Cheracebus Diphylla
Species Cheracebus medemi Diphylla ecaudata

Evolutionary Relationship

Black-handed Titi and Hairy-legged Vampire Bat share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(memeliler)
